With Perkins out. I wanted to know what other people would decide on between these three choices all being located in Seattle:
K&L Gates
Pros:
National (or International) Reputation
Market Pay ($125k? Not on NALP anymore)
Cool People
Third Largest Firm in Town
Cons:
Not a perfect offer rate (Seattle: 6 out of 7; Nationally: 71 out of 76)
Not HQ
Davis Wright Tremaine:
Pros:
Market Pay ($120k)
Cool People
Second Largest Firm In Seattle
Higher Regional Ranking
HQ in Seattle
Cons:
Not a National Reputation (Less Exit Options?)
Unclear Offer Rate
Satellite Offices (think Wilson Sonsini, DLA, Fenwick, Cooley, Orrick, etc.).:
Pros:
Above Market Pay ($160k)
Interesting Work (Start-ups/VC)
Perfect Offer Rates
Bro-y people
Cons:
Work longer
Inability to change practice area
Limited Exit Options?
Less opportunities to become partner
Not HQ
